Commit Graph

8 Commits

Author SHA1 Message Date
Vantz Stockwell
6fa8f6c5d8 feat: settings — key/value store with CRUD API
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-12 17:09:08 -04:00
Vantz Stockwell
5762eb706e feat: vault — encrypted credentials + SSH key management
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-12 17:08:53 -04:00
Vantz Stockwell
41411b0cb8 feat: connection manager — hosts + groups CRUD with search
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-12 17:08:00 -04:00
Vantz Stockwell
3b9a0118b5 feat: AES-256-GCM encryption service + auth module (JWT, guards, seed)
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-12 17:07:14 -04:00
Vantz Stockwell
5a6c376821 feat: Prisma schema (7 models) + NestJS bootstrap
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-12 17:06:09 -04:00
Vantz Stockwell
88dbb99f9d feat: project scaffold — Docker, NestJS, Nuxt 3, Prisma config
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-03-12 17:05:37 -04:00
Vantz Stockwell
99f3c5caab fix: plan — async host key verification via ssh2 verify callback 2026-03-12 17:02:20 -04:00
Vantz Stockwell
de1bb71173 docs: Wraith spec + implementation plan 2026-03-12 16:59:34 -04:00